[ULPIANUS libro septuagesimo sexto ad edictum. ] §35.2.46.prQui quod per Falcidiam retinere poterat, uoluntatem testatoris secutus spopondit se daturum, cogendus est soluere.
[ULPIANUS in the seventy-sixth book on the Edict.] He who, having followed the will of the testator, promised that he would give what he could have retained under the Lex Falcidia, shall be compelled to pay.
